2025中国最具投资价值城市50强指数发布!北上广深包揽前四,杭州位居第五
Sou Hu Cai Jing· 2025-08-26 11:33
Core Insights - The article highlights the acceleration of global changes and the importance of high-level openness and technological innovation in driving China's economic growth, particularly in urban investment value and potential [2][10]. Investment Value Rankings - GYBrand's 2025 "Top 50 Most Investable Cities in China" index ranks Shenzhen, Shanghai, Beijing, and Guangzhou as the top four cities, with Hangzhou, Chengdu, Wuhan, Suzhou, Nanjing, and Chongqing following in the top ten [2][4][6]. City Characteristics - Shenzhen leads with a comprehensive index of 95.07, excelling in talent attraction, sustainable development, and future industries, supported by policies like housing subsidies [6][7]. - Shanghai ranks second with a score of 94.34, benefiting from a robust economic foundation and a favorable business environment, particularly in its free trade zone [6][7]. - Beijing, in third place with 93.70, leverages its educational resources and strong policy support to foster emerging industries like AI and biomedicine [6][7]. - Guangzhou, ranked fourth with 92.16, is noted for its quality of life and balanced economic and cultural offerings [7]. Regional Distribution - The cities exhibit a diverse distribution pattern, with strong representation from the eastern coastal cities, which dominate the top rankings due to their economic strength and infrastructure [3][10]. - Central cities like Wuhan and Changsha are emerging as investment hotspots due to their transportation and educational resources [11]. - Western cities such as Chengdu and Chongqing are gaining traction through policy support and complementary industries [11]. Trends in Urban Development - Cities are diversifying their industrial bases, focusing on strategic emerging industries and future-oriented sectors, with Shenzhen and Hangzhou leading in digital economy and AI [15]. - Regional collaboration is strengthening among city clusters like the Yangtze River Delta and the Guangdong-Hong Kong-Macau Greater Bay Area, enhancing overall investment value [15][16]. - There is a growing emphasis on talent attraction and innovation, with cities implementing policies to draw skilled professionals and increase investment in technology [15]. Future Outlook - The acceleration of digital transformation and green transition is expected to create new investment hotspots, with cities investing in new infrastructure like 5G and big data [15]. - The integration of city clusters is deepening, leading to more refined industrial divisions and enhanced resource sharing, which will further elevate investment value [16].

湖北:“十四五”高新企业增长近两倍,技术合同成交额全国第3
2 1 Shi Ji Jing Ji Bao Dao· 2025-08-22 01:34
Core Insights - Hubei Province has made significant progress in technological innovation during the "14th Five-Year Plan" period, with a 6.98 percentage point increase in the regional comprehensive technology innovation level index compared to 2020, ranking first in Central China and among the top in the nation [1] Group 1: Technological Innovation Achievements - Hubei has strengthened the construction of innovation platforms, achieving a breakthrough with the establishment of the Hanjiang Laboratory and the approval of national laboratories [1] - The number of major national scientific and technological infrastructure in Hubei has reached 8, with 45 national key laboratories, ranking 4th in the country [1] - The province has seen a surge in new research and development institutions, totaling 545, placing it among the top in the nation [1][2] Group 2: Major Innovation Outcomes - Key breakthroughs in basic research include the discovery of key genes for increasing corn and rice yields and the creation of new world records in pulsed magnetic fields [2] - In strategic fields, Hubei has made significant advancements in three-dimensional flash memory chip technology and centimeter-level satellite navigation precision [2] - The province has achieved multiple world records in optical transmission with self-developed "hollow core fibers" and has broken international monopolies in key equipment such as high-power lasers [2] Group 3: Industrial Upgrading and Economic Growth - Hubei's high-tech enterprises have nearly doubled from 10,404 at the end of the "13th Five-Year Plan" to nearly 30,000, while technology-based small and medium-sized enterprises have increased over fivefold [3] - The total transaction amount of technology contracts has risen from 168.7 billion to 550 billion, ranking 3rd in the nation, with a consistent annual increase of over 100 billion [3] - The core industry value added of the digital economy has grown by 139%, from 240.2 billion to 574.3 billion [3] Group 4: Future Development Plans - Hubei is advancing traditional industry upgrades, emerging industry growth, and future industry cultivation simultaneously, with a focus on establishing a "51020" advanced manufacturing industry cluster [4] - The province aims for its five pillar industries to achieve a breakthrough of over one trillion yuan by the end of the "14th Five-Year Plan" [4] - Hubei is preparing for new requirements and opportunities in the "15th Five-Year Plan" period, aiming to become a nationally influential technology innovation hub [4]

“1小时高铁圈”今年底成型,汉襄宜“金三角”含金量有多高
Di Yi Cai Jing· 2025-08-20 07:47
Core Insights - The formation of a "1-hour high-speed rail circle" among Wuhan, Xiangyang, and Yichang is expected to enhance the integrated benefits of the Han-Xiang-Yi "Golden Triangle" as the Han-Yi and Xiang-Jing high-speed rail lines are set to be completed by the end of this year [1] - Hubei has achieved its economic growth target for the 14th Five-Year Plan a year ahead of schedule, with a total economic output surpassing 6 trillion yuan, increasing its share of the central region's economy from 19.5% at the end of the 13th Five-Year Plan to an expected 20.9% by 2024 [1] Economic Development - The Wuhan metropolitan area has successfully addressed 32 bottleneck roads, establishing a dual hub for air passenger and cargo transport between Ezhou Huahu Airport and Wuhan Tianhe Airport, and is advancing the Optoelectronic Information Industry to a trillion-yuan scale [2] - By 2024, the economic output of the Wuhan metropolitan area is projected to reach 3.6 trillion yuan, increasing its share of the Yangtze River middle reaches urban agglomeration to 29% [2] Regional Collaboration - Wuhan is enhancing cooperation with other central provincial capitals such as Changsha, Hefei, and Nanchang in transportation, technology, industry, and public services [2] - The Xiangyang metropolitan area has seen its economic output jump from 500 billion yuan in 2021 to 600 billion yuan in 2024, ranking among the top non-provincial cities in Central China [3] Industrial Growth - Xiangyang is developing a collaborative automotive industry cluster with Wuhan, Shiyan, and Suizhou, while also establishing a national-level phosphate chemical circular industry cluster with Yichang, Jingmen, and Jingzhou [4] - Yichang is focusing on ecological and green development, with its GDP reaching 619.1 billion yuan, making it the top non-provincial city in Central China [4] County-Level Economic Development - Hubei has increased its number of top 100 counties to 8, ranking 4th nationally, with a breakthrough in the number of counties achieving a GDP of over 100 billion yuan [5] - The urbanization rate of the county's permanent population has reached 56.7%, an increase of 3.44 percentage points from the end of the 13th Five-Year Plan [5]

制度为基 创新为要 协同为魂
Zhong Guo Zhi Liang Xin Wen Wang· 2025-08-19 06:33
Core Viewpoint - Hubei Province is actively exploring new paths for quality enhancement in industrial chains, guided by the principles of institutional foundation, innovation as a priority, and collaboration as the essence, aiming for high-quality industrial development [1] Group 1: Quality Improvement Initiatives - Over the past five years, Hubei has implemented 155 provincial quality improvement projects, with nearly 30 million yuan in provincial funding, leveraging over 35 million yuan in local matching funds, serving 65,200 enterprises, and resolving 39,600 quality issues, resulting in over 40 billion yuan in cost savings and increased revenue for upstream and downstream enterprises [1] - The provincial government has established a collaborative mechanism involving "chain leaders, chain masters, and chain innovators" to address quality bottlenecks in industrial chains, with significant achievements in the optoelectronic information industry, which saw revenues exceed 847 billion yuan in 2023 [2] Group 2: Legislative and Standardization Efforts - Hubei has included the "Hubei Quality Promotion Regulations" in the 2023 legislative plan, becoming the third province in China to legislate for industrial chain quality enhancement, providing a stable legal environment for quality improvement [3] - The province has developed guidelines for quality improvement projects and established local standards to standardize the entire process from project planning to benefit evaluation, promoting a virtuous cycle of project implementation and industry development [3] Group 3: Financial and Technical Support - Hubei has created a support system combining special policies, matching funds, and ongoing guarantees, with provincial funding of nearly 30 million yuan since the 14th Five-Year Plan, which has attracted over 35 million yuan in local matching funds [4] - The province has established a "one-stop" service system for quality infrastructure, with 240 service stations and 446 service windows, benefiting 37,000 enterprises and saving them 326 million yuan [4] Group 4: Talent and Financial Integration - Hubei has initiated measures to attract talent and financial resources to industrial chains, including the introduction of a quality management self-study examination and the "E-Zhi Loan" financing enhancement system, which has facilitated loans totaling 23.47 billion yuan for 4,378 enterprises, with 94.36% being small and micro enterprises [5] Group 5: Overall Quality Improvement - The province has implemented a "provincial planning + local details" policy framework, selecting 69 out of 91 proposed quality improvement projects for implementation, leading to a significant increase in quality competitiveness across 12 out of 17 major industries [6] - Hubei has developed a "Five Ones" working method to enhance quality improvement, focusing on precise service delivery to address quality challenges faced by enterprises [6] Group 6: Industry-Specific Achievements - The optoelectronic information industry has achieved a 25% international market share for core products, with significant contributions to international standard-setting [7] - The automotive industry has made strides in overcoming core bottlenecks related to automotive-grade chips, with a 35% year-on-year increase in new energy vehicle production in Wuhan [8] - The rail transit industry has achieved an 18% domestic market share, exporting to over 20 countries, through comprehensive standardization efforts [8] Group 7: Quality Metrics - Hubei's manufacturing product quality compliance rate improved from 92.65% in 2020 to 94.33% in 2024, with the quality competitiveness index rising from 84.41 to 88.4, both exceeding the national average [9]
人民日报头版关注 “武汉造”
Ren Min Ri Bao· 2025-08-17 13:19
Core Viewpoint - The article emphasizes the importance of developing new quality productivity in Wuhan, highlighting the city's efforts in traditional industry transformation, emerging industry growth, and future industry layout, driven by technological innovation and government support [14][15][17]. Group 1: Traditional Industry Transformation - Wuhan's Dongfeng Motor Corporation has developed a new energy vehicle equipped with a domestically produced high-performance microcontroller chip, set to be mass-produced next year [15]. - The city's automotive industry has seen significant growth, with new energy vehicle production reaching 168,000 units in the first half of the year, a year-on-year increase of 152% [15]. - Traditional industries in Wuhan are undergoing revitalization, with examples such as the transformation of the old WISCO plant into a green super factory and the digitalization of the century-old pharmaceutical brand, Mayinglong [15][16]. Group 2: Emerging Industry Development - Wuhan's optical electronics industry, particularly in the "China Optics Valley," is expanding with a focus on innovation and industry chain improvement, aiming for over 20% annual growth [16]. - The scale of the optical fiber and cable industry in Wuhan has surpassed 600 billion yuan, showcasing the city's strength in this sector [16]. - Companies like Changfei Optical Fiber and Huagong Technology are leading advancements in optical technology, enhancing signal transmission speeds and precision manufacturing capabilities [16]. Group 3: Future Industry Layout - Wuhan is making strides in the field of brain-computer interfaces, with the first clinical application and surgery completed in the region, indicating rapid advancements in this cutting-edge technology [17]. - The city is focusing on 13 key areas, including humanoid robots and new energy storage, to establish a competitive future industry landscape [17]. - The local government is committed to integrating technological innovation with existing industries to enhance productivity and quality, aligning with national development goals [17].
